These are three qualities we have distinguished, which you can employ to better your experience at events.
1. Being Proactive.
This means that when you are at an event, you don’t just hang around the people you came with. You are proactive. You make the effort to approach people you do not know, or would like to know more. You start interesting conversations. And you take initiatives to laugh, play, and deepen relationships.
2. Being Open.
This means that when you are looking at someone, or talking to someone, that you do not prejudge who they are. You are open to their perspectives, their behaviors, and their lifestyle choices. You truly consider what the other person has to say, and you allow for a space which has them feel accepted.
3. Being Authentic.
This means that when you are sharing with someone, you don’t try to put up an image or hold status. You’re more than honest, you’re vulnerable. You take the time to express yourself completely, so that you can have substance to your connections.
